Sevetri Wilson Taylor is the Co-Founder and CEO of Prosperall, an enterprise AI platform revolutionizing how U.S. cities operate. Prosperall harnesses artificial intelligence to unify and analyze complex data in real time, enabling governments to make faster, smarter decisions and deliver services more effectively from a single source of truth. A seasoned entrepreneur with over a 15-years of experience at the intersection of technology, equity, and systems change, Sevetri has built a career focused on solving real problems for under-resourced communities across the country. Before Prosperall, she founded Resilia, a venture-backed technology company that raised $50 million in 2022—making Sevetri the first solo Black woman founder to secure such a round and the largest round ever raised by a woman founder in the South. She successfully exited Resilia in 2023. Her bestselling book, Resilient, debuted on the Wall Street Journal Best Sellers list in 2021. Sevetri’s leadership and impact have earned widespread recognition. She has been named one of Inc. Magazine’s 100 Female Founders, featured in PitchBook’s Top 27 Black Founders and Investors, and honored by Entrepreneur Magazine as one of the 100 Most Powerful Women of 2022. She was also selected for Black Enterprise’s 40 Under 40. An alumna of Louisiana State University, where she earned a dual degree in Mass Communication and History, Sevetri later studied at the Harvard Kennedy School. She is an Aspen Institute Henry Crown Fellow and a Board Trustee for the National Urban League in New York City. She also sits on the boards of the NOCCA Foundation and the LSU Foundation’s National Board. In addition to her leadership roles, Sevetri is a prolific angel investor, having backed more than two dozen companies across industries
